Watch Trailer
DISCLAIMER: Not all titles shown are currently available on all streaming providers.

Watch Voltron: Defender of the Universe Season 2 Episode 8 Online

  • 7.8/10
  • Subtitles: English

The Explorer arrives at a new planet, only to find a strange Ghost Fleet appearing and disappearing around the globe. Intrigued, the Voltron Force begins a wild goose chase as the Explorer waits in a central lake. Hawkins has a bad feeling that the planet holds a terrible secret, but will they figure it out before the Ghost Fleet strikes?